Our Process, From Design to a Paint Ready Finish
1. Site visit and design planning
We start with measurements, photos, and a discussion of what you want the space to feel like. We consider ceiling height, wall thickness, existing framing, and where lighting will fall. For arches, we define the radius and reveal depth so the curve looks balanced rather than tight or oversized.
2. Structural preparation and framing
Decorative plasterboard must be supported correctly to prevent cracks and movement. We create accurate templates for curves, then build the backing using suitable profiles and fixings. When the ornament ties into ceilings or partitions, we ensure it integrates cleanly with existing framing and boards, including any required movement gaps.
3. Forming curves and shapes
Depending on the design, we use pre formed methods, carefully scored boards, or layered sections to achieve smooth curvature. Edges are reinforced and aligned for symmetry. We focus on straight sight lines and consistent thickness, especially where arches meet walls or where ceiling figures must look centered from the main viewpoints in the room.
4. Jointing, detailing, and finishing
We tape, fill, and refine surfaces to achieve sharp corners or seamless transitions, depending on the style you choose. Final surfaces are prepared for paint, wallpaper, or decorative coating. If your project includes lighting features, we plan access points and clean openings for LED strips, spotlights, and hidden drivers.

Pricing and What Affects Cost
The price depends on the complexity of the design, the size of the feature, ceiling height, and how much preparation is required. Curved and layered details take more time than simple straight trims. Integrated lighting, multiple levels, or symmetrical ceiling figures also affect labor and materials. FAQ
Can you build a plasterboard arch in an existing doorway without replacing the whole wall?
Yes, in many cases we can form an arch within the existing opening by adding framing and shaped plasterboard layers. We check wall thickness, stability, and clearance first to ensure the result is durable and symmetrical.
Are plasterboard ceiling figures suitable for LED strip lighting?
Yes, many ceiling ornaments are designed specifically to hide LED strips and create soft indirect light. We plan cable routes, driver access, and clean openings so the lighting is easy to service later.
How long does it take to install and finish an arch or decorative ceiling feature?
Simple arches can often be installed within a day, while larger ceiling figures may take several days including jointing and drying time. The final timeline depends on complexity and the finish level required for painting.
